A 13-year-old Michigan girl who was found dead on Monday reportedly came to school with injuries months before her death.

Kayleene Hairabedian, who was Keimani Latigue’s sixth-grade English teacher, told the Toledo Blade that she regularly came to school with injuries last year. Hairabedian said she and other teachers reported this to authorities, though it is unclear if they ever intervened.

“She would have welt marks on the back of her neck, back, and stomach,” Hairabedian told the publication. “She was constantly bruised. She was fearful of going home.”

Latigue vanished from her Toledo home on March 17. A week later, she was found dead on the second floor of a burned-out house. Lucas County coroners said she died from multiple incised wounds of the neck. According to FOP official Brian Steel, she was raped, had her hands severed, and her throat nearly cut off.

On Monday, the day Latigue’s body was discovered, an arrest warrant was issued for her father, Darnell Jones, 33, for child abduction. He is now charged with murder, felonious assault, and third-degree felony abduction.

Before his arrest, Jones said he last saw Latigue on March 16 after she called and said she was afraid to be home alone. However, police said Jones provided inconsistent accounts of his correspondence with his daughter or her whereabouts.

Reports indicated that Latigue lived with her grandmother for the past five years. The grandmother reported Latigue missing on March 18, a day after she came home and found the house in disarray.

Jones’ arraignment was originally scheduled for Wednesday. However, it was postponed because he remains hospitalized for a gunshot wound he sustained in Tuesday’s SWAT standoff in Columbus that ended with his arrest.

A motive in Latigue’s murder remains undisclosed. The Toledo Blade reported that Jones is in stable condition.
